Just a quick thought: it wasn't only the adults that got their teams disqualified. The buttons, balls and controls could not be touched by the team members that had yellow dots on their pink buttons. On many teams, drivers, controlers and human players rotated with the two student coaches in different matches. In some cases, the student who had on the button with the yellow dot hit the stop button and the team was disqualified.
